Invictus Yacht has introduced its new flagship, the TT550, at the 2025 Cannes Yachting Festival and the Genoa International Boat Show. At 55 feet length overall with a beam of 16 feet, 6 inches, the TT550 is the latest evolution of the builder’s TT line, designed by Christian Grande with exterior spaces that emphasize open-air living.

The yacht features folding side terraces, a semi-reverse bow, and a large aft sun pad, complemented by a submersible swim platform and a carbon fiber hardtop shading the dinette and galley. Forward, a lounge area sits beneath a carbon fiber canopy, complete with ambient lighting. Storage is handled via a concealed garage, keeping guest spaces clear for relaxation and socializing.

Technology plays a key role in the TT550’s performance and efficiency. Structural fiberglass fuel and water tanks are integrated into the hull for rigidity and balance, while the use of PET, a recyclable thermoplastic resin, reduces weight and improves fuel economy. Power comes from twin Volvo Penta IPS950s.

Customization is central to the model, with owners able to configure layouts through Atelier Invictus, choosing among multiple cabin arrangements, finishes, and materials. Two standard staterooms (master and VIP) and two heads can be supplemented with a third cabin, a central galley or as crew quarters. Exterior color and upholstery palettes, along with newly developed water-resistant textiles, add further personalization.
